As the MLA Handbook notes (1.2), a title like Dr. or Sir should not be included before a name mentioned in the text and is usually unnecessary to include in your works-cited-list entry. You might, however, explain the qualifications of an author in the body of your essay if ...

AMA Style uses superscripts in the text, which correspond to an entry in a “References” section at the end of the paper. Number your references at the end of your document in the order they first appear in the text; do not alphabetize. Use the author’s last name followed by initials and without periods in reference lists. slugs toxicWebMLA (Modern Language Association) style is most commonly used to write papers and cite sources within the liberal arts and humanities.
